Venous Thromboembolism Prevention in Rehabilitation: A Review and Practice Suggestions
William H Geerts1, Eric Jeong, Lawrence R Robinson
1From the Thromboembolism Program, Sunnybrook Health Sciences Centre (WHG); Department of Medicine, University of Toronto, Toronto, ON, Canada (WHG); Division of Physical Medicine and Rehabilitation, University of Toronto, Toronto, ON, Canada (EJ); Sunnybrook Health Sciences Centre, Toronto, ON, Canada (LRR, HK); Division of Physical Medicine and Rehabilitation, University of Toronto, Toronto, ON, Canada (LRR); and Division of Neurology, University of Toronto, Toronto, ON, Canada (HK).
Abstract:
Venous thromboembolism is a frequent complication of acute hospital care, and this extends to inpatient rehabilitation. The timely use of appropriate thromboprophylaxis in patients who are at risk is a strong, evidence-based patient safety priority that has reduced clinically important venous thromboembolism, associated mortality and costs of care. While there has been extensive research on optimal approaches to venous thromboembolism prophylaxis in acute care, there is a paucity of high-quality evidence specific to patients in the rehabilitation setting, and there are no clinical practice guidelines that make recommendations for (or against) thromboprophylaxis across the broad spectrum of rehabilitation patients. Herein, we provide an evidence-informed review of the topic with practice suggestions. We conducted a series of literature searches to assess the risks of venous thromboembolism and its prevention related to inpatient rehabilitation as well as in major rehabilitation subgroups. Mobilization alone does not eliminate the risk of venous thromboembolism after another thrombotic insult. Low molecular weight heparins and direct oral anticoagulants are the principal current modalities of thromboprophylaxis. Based on the literature, we make suggestions for venous thromboembolism prevention and include an approach for consideration by rehabilitation units that can be aligned with local practice.
